Kentucky 2025 Regular Session
Legislative Ethics Commission (3-17-25) - Part 3
Summary:
The committee took up a personnel action package. A motion was made and approved to recognize the appointments of Denita Kiten as assistant executive director, effective March 16, 2025, at a salary of $90,000 per year, and Lorie Smither as executive assistant to the commission, effective March 16, 2025, at a salary of $80,000 per year. The motion also included increasing the executive director’s salary to $135,000 effective March 16, 2025.
In the same motion, the committee approved the part-time employment of John Scott as fiscal officer to assist with budget preparation and review at a rate of $50 per hour beginning April 1, 2025. The motion was seconded, there was no discussion, and it passed by voice vote.
The meeting then moved to adjournment. A motion to adjourn was made and seconded, and the committee voted to adjourn, with the next meeting tentatively discussed as April 8 but ultimately left without a firm date.
